Infinity Wards confirmed that the PC version of Modern Warfare 3 will have LAN support. Studio comms boss Rob Bowling spilled the news in a tweet: Yes, #MW3 has LAN along with detailed class restriction control + default class creation option. He also specified how those restrictions played out, adding: Ability to restrict any weapon, equipment, perk, deathstreak, secondary, attachment, ANYTHING from being used when setting up game,

omnomis said:The gun sounds are actually quite a lot more realistic. You can hear the change in audio design philosophy from MW2 especially with guns like the UMP and ACR 6.8. The shots are much more of a sharp crack than they were in the last game.
http://www.gamespot.com/events/codx...ry=highlights&hd=1&tag=top_stories;play_btn;5
The spec ops survival section of this video is a great overview of the guns compared to most of the multiplayer gameplay. The SCAR-L, new ACR and the new Colt rifle actually sound like high caliber assault rifles with a realistic assault rifle rate of fire, and the MP5 has a much wimpier sound which is accurate to it being an SMG. In Modern Warfare 2, guns like the ACR and M4 were so high rate of fire and sounded so similar in scale to the MP5K and UMP that without knowing which sound matched which gun, you probably couldn't tell which were ARs and which were SMGs.
